Emergency Livestock Assistance Program (ELAP) payments in Weston County, Wyoming totaled $2.8 million in 2022

In 2022, the top 10 percent of Emergency Livestock Assistance Program (ELAP) payment recipients were paid 37 percent of Emergency Livestock Assistance Program (ELAP) recipients.
